Anonymous wrote:Pool board member here and enthusiastic swim team parent. Say something,

Send a kindly worded email to the board (not a rant) with a list of suggestions for how to reduce conflict that you’ve heard have been successful at other pools and ask that it be discussed at the next meeting to see if any of could be implemented this season or next. Include low hanging fruit as well as more major things? At our board meetings we really do try to consider perspectives of all pool members and find solutions (for example! We have afternoon practice but only a couple lanes and coaches remind families they are only for those families who really can’t make the morning). I’d include things like designated area for swim team families to leave stuff during practice so can’t take over pool grounds before opens to public, no bullhorns while pool is open to public, latest morning practice is for teens [added bonus is this makes it easier for more younger families to do morning practice and camp), and limiting lanes for afternoon practice. Like anything, speak up, offer reasonable solutions, and you may see change.
